A defining story submitted by Fevvers - STAR473 on August 19, 2014, 8:24pm Knightfall is a defining part of the long-running Batman stories, and has been very influential on subsequent comics and clearly on the Christopher Nolan movies. It proves that Batman is human, but also that he is, well, Batman. It's a bit brutal but very well done.
Overrated submitted by SaraP on July 25, 2019, 12:17pm An interesting idea, Bane pits Batman against all the other villains before they finally square off as Batman is weary and hurt. It's plodding and over-written though.
